Transaction 4af3067984a3956c4ccb871359d753f72cb60774717310c0e4c71cc748b6df36
1 Input
1 Output
-
4af3067984a3956c4ccb871359d753f72cb60774717310c0e4c71cc748b6df36:0
- value
- 334315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ba74a87d1da7932bce5911a6bd4e1486dd438fe2 OP_EQUAL
- address
- 3JguMmv3sEdNQyNMdWbF6QrkVtaK73EFxJ